If you’re starting tirzepatide for weight loss or thinking about it, you might be wondering: Does tirzepatide give you more energy or make you feel tired?
The short answer is that it can do both.
Some people notice steadier, more consistent energy, while others feel a temporary dip during the first few weeks.
Here’s exactly why that happens, what to expect, and how to support your energy levels throughout your tirzepatide journey.

Many people report clearer, more stable energy, especially after their body adjusts.
That improvement typically comes from:
When blood sugar rises and crashes throughout the day, your energy swings with it.
Tirzepatide helps smooth out those fluctuations, which often creates steadier daytime energy.
With appetite under control, your body avoids the heavy, sluggish feelings that follow big meals or sugar spikes.
Studies show that tirzepatide can improve your bodies response to insulin.
As your body becomes more responsive to insulin, it uses fuel in a more stable way, leading to less mid-afternoon fatigue.
If your blood sugar was unstable before starting tirzepatide, the improvements can help support more restful sleep, which naturally boosts daytime energy.
While some people feel an immediate boost, others experience tiredness early on.
The most common reasons include:
Appetite can drop quickly, which means you might not get enough calories or nutrients, leading to fatigue.
Low appetite often means smaller, less balanced meals.
Without adequate protein, many people notice low energy.
Reduced food intake can throw off hydration, and even mild dehydration can make you feel tired or sluggish.
Each time your dose increases, your body goes through a short adjustment period.
Temporary fatigue is very normal.
Some people experience brief changes in sleep during dose titration.
These early symptoms usually fade once your routine stabilizes.

| Phase | What You Might Feel | Why It Happens |
| Early (Weeks 1–3) | Mild fatigue, lighter appetite, some nausea | Dose adjustment, rapid appetite suppression, low protein or hydration |
| Later (Weeks 4+) | Steady energy, better clarity, fewer crashes | Stabilized blood sugar, consistent nutrition, improved metabolic function |

Tirzepatide can absolutely support better energy levels, especially once your body adapts and your nutrition is consistent.
Early fatigue is common, but it’s usually temporary and manageable.
With guidance, balanced eating, and proper hydration, most people notice steadier, clearer energy as they continue their weight-loss journey.
How to get more energy while on tirzepatide?
Most people feel more energized when they eat enough protein, stay well-hydrated, include electrolytes, avoid skipping meals, and maintain a consistent sleep schedule. Light daily movement can also help boost energy while your body adjusts to the medication.
What are the positive effects of tirzepatide?
People often experience reduced appetite, steadier blood sugar, fewer cravings, improved metabolic function, and more predictable energy throughout the day. Many also notice clearer focus and better portion control as their body adapts.
Does tirzepatide help with fatigue?
Tirzepatide may improve fatigue once blood sugar stabilizes and nutrition becomes consistent. Some people feel tired during the first few weeks, but this usually improves as they adjust and begin eating balanced meals with adequate protein.
Can tirzepatide help with sleep apnea?
Tirzepatide is not a treatment for sleep apnea, but weight loss from the medication may help reduce the severity of symptoms for some individuals. Any changes should be discussed with a healthcare provider.
Does tirzepatide burn fat?
Tirzepatide supports fat loss by regulating appetite, improving insulin sensitivity, and helping the body use energy more efficiently. Many people experience significant fat reduction as part of their weight-loss journey.
